Transaction 8bc58df384928cc50e3dfedc25c865822af34e2dc38191233d365ba9f90d4892
1 Input
1 Output
-
8bc58df384928cc50e3dfedc25c865822af34e2dc38191233d365ba9f90d4892:0
- value
- 17279649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c81abd4c1f80144a54c1f5dea7fd3e0200aab9d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KeLBr9cLoZrPm3ZD5ebG5GB6BaY36htP5